awk处理txt格式的问题[把^M处理掉就正常,没处理掉转csv也是错误处理】 并不要去列号相等####

    科技2026-06-18  9

    awk处理txt格式的问题 [把^M处理掉就正常,没处理掉转csv也是错误处理】

    并不要去列号相等####

    awk ’ {if (ARGIND==1) grade[$3] = $0} {if (ARGIND>1 && ($2 in grade)) print grade[$2]} ’ c d |head

    awk ’ NR==FNR {a[$3]=$0;next} NR!=FNR {if($2 in a)print a[$2]} ’ c d |head

    (base) [zhangyong@cluster kang]$ awk ’ NRFNR {a[$2]=$0;next} NR!=FNR {if($2 in a)print a[KaTeX parse error: Expected 'EOF', got '}' at position 3: 2]}̲ ' chang duan |… awk ’ NRFNR {a[$2]=$0;next} NR!=FNR {if($2 in a)print a[KaTeX parse error: Expected 'EOF', got '}' at position 3: 2]}̲ ' ff.csv gg.cs…

    下面两家话等价, awk ’ {if (ARGIND1) grade[$2] = $0} {if (ARGIND>1 && ($2 in grade)) print grade[$2]} ’ chang duan |head awk ’ NRFNR {a[$2]=$0;next} NR!=FNR {if($2 in a)print a[$2]} ’ chang duan |head

    yyp@DESKTOP-U0COGSO:~/yang/nr$ cat c 1 4 lisi 88 2 4 bokeyuan 97 3 6 zhangsan 77 4 7 wangwu 89 5 1 hongliu 92 6 0 zhanghua 97 yyp@DESKTOP-U0COGSO:~/yang/nr$ cat d 3 zhangsan 5 hongliu yyp@DESKTOP-U0COGSO:~/yang/nr$ yyp@DESKTOP-U0COGSO:~/yang/nr$ awk ’ {if (ARGIND1) grade[$3] = $0} {if (ARGIND>1 && ($2 in grade)) print grade[KaTeX parse error: Expected 'EOF', got '}' at position 3: 2]}̲ ' c d |head 3 … awk ’ NRFNR {a[$3]=$0;next} NR!=FNR {if($2 in a)print a[KaTeX parse error: Expected 'EOF', got '}' at position 3: 2]}̲ ' c d |head 3 …

    Processed: 0.013, SQL: 9